Ryanair is claiming a record of more than 29 million website visits and bookings during a ten-day long ‘cyber week’ sale.
The total is more traffic than Tesco’s website receives in a month and more than premiership football club Chelsea FC receives in six months, according to the no-frills carrier.
Cyber Monday, December 2, saw record visits and bookings with more than six million visits to the Ryanair.com website.
Chief marketing officer Kenny Jacobs said: “Cyber Monday was our busiest ever day for bookings, with over six million visits to the Ryanair.com website, more than the population of Denmark, Ireland or Norway.
“These record visits and bookings reflect continued demand for our low fares, lowest emissions and an even greater choice of destinations on offer.”
